Научная статья на тему 'Прогнозирование электропотребления с использованием искусственных нейронных сетей'

Прогнозирование электропотребления с использованием искусственных нейронных сетей Текст научной статьи по специальности «Компьютерные и информационные науки»

CC BY
116
31
i Надоели баннеры? Вы всегда можете отключить рекламу.
Ключевые слова
КАЧЕСТВО ЭЛЕКТРОЭНЕРГИИ / POWER QUALITY / НЕЙРОННЫЕ СЕТИ / ПРОГНОЗИРОВАНИЕ ЭЛЕКТРОПОТРЕБЛЕНИЯ / FORECASTING OF A POWER CONSUMPTION ARTIFICIAL NEURAL NETWORKS

Аннотация научной статьи по компьютерным и информационным наукам, автор научной работы — Орлов Дмитрий Викторович, Таран Ангелина Викторовна, Зиновьев Евгений Викторович, Мумладзе Даниэль Григорьевич

В статье описаны возможности применения нейронных сетей для прогнозирования электропотребления какого-либо объекта. Дано понятие и представление о нейронных сетях и их методах рассчета

i Надоели баннеры? Вы всегда можете отключить рекламу.

Похожие темы научных работ по компьютерным и информационным наукам , автор научной работы — Орлов Дмитрий Викторович, Таран Ангелина Викторовна, Зиновьев Евгений Викторович, Мумладзе Даниэль Григорьевич

iНе можете найти то, что вам нужно? Попробуйте сервис подбора литературы.
i Надоели баннеры? Вы всегда можете отключить рекламу.

FORECASTING OF A POWER CONSUMPTION WITH USE OF ARTIFICIAL NEURAL NETWORKS

Possibilities of application of neural networks for forecasting of a power consumption of any object are described in the article. The concept and idea of neural networks and their methods of calculation is given.

Текст научной работы на тему «Прогнозирование электропотребления с использованием искусственных нейронных сетей»

http://www.symantec.com/content/ en/us/ enterprise/ other_resources/b-intelligence_ report_07-2014.en-us.pdf (дата обращения 01.02.2015) 2. Гарнаева М.А., Функ К. KasperskySecurityBulletin 2013// Вопросы кибербезопасности. - 2013 - № 3(4). - С. 65 - 68.

3. Нестеров С. Управление рисками. Модель безопасности с полным перекрытием. URL: http://www. intuit.ru/studies/courses/531/387/lecture/8990 (дата обращения 01.02.2015)

ПРОГНОЗИРОВАНИЕ ЭЛЕКТРОПОТРЕБЛЕНИЯ С ИСПОЛЬЗОВАНИЕМ ИСКУССТВЕННЫХ НЕЙРОННЫХ СЕТЕЙ

Орлов Дмитрий Викторович

Студент, Омский Государственный Технический Университет, г. Омск

Таран Ангелина Викторовна Студент, Омский Государственный Технический Университет, г. Омск

Зиновьев Евгений Викторович Студент, Омский Государственный Технический Университет, г. Омск

Мумладзе Даниэль Григорьевич Студент, Омский Государственный Технический Университет, г. Омск

FORECASTING OF A POWER CONSUMPTION WITH USE OF ARTIFICIAL NEURAL NETWORKS. Orlov Dmitriy Victorovich, Student of Omsk State Technical University, Omsk Taran Angelina Victorovna, Student of Omsk State Technical University, Omsk Zinoviev Engeniy Victorovich, Student of Omsk State Technical University, Omsk Mumladze Daniel Grigorievich, Student of Omsk State Technical University, Omsk АННОТАЦИЯ

В статье описаны возможности применения нейронных сетей для прогнозирования электропотребления какого-либо объекта. Дано понятие и представление о нейронных сетях и их методах рассчета. ABSTRACT

Possibilities of application of neural networks for forecasting of a power consumption of any object are described in the article. The concept and idea of neural networks and their methods of calculation is given.

Ключевые слова: Качество электроэнергии; прогнозирование электропотребления; нейронные сети. Keywords: Power quality; forecasting of a power consumption artificial neural networks.

Под нейронными сетями подразумеваются вычислительные структуры, которые моделируют простые биологические процессы, обычно ассоциируемые с процессами головного мозга. Они представляют собой распределенные и параллельные системы, способные к адап-

тивному обучению путем анализа положительных и отрицательных воздействий. Элементарным преобразователем в данных сетях является искусственный нейрон или просто нейрон, названный так по аналогии с биологическим прототипом.

Синалтические веса

Рис. 1 Модель нейрона

Искусственные нейронные сети (ИНС) представляют собой не один обособленный предмет, а совокупность множества дисциплин, таких как: нейрофизиология, математика, статистика, физика, компьютерные науки, техника и т.п. Применяются ИНС так же в различных областях: анализ временных рядов, обработка сигналов и управление, распознавание образов. Нейронные сети являются одним из самых популярнейших и распространенных методов прогнозирования, благодаря тому, что они

имеют ряд существенных преимуществ над остальными методами:

• Позволяет устанавливать сложные зависимости энергопотребления от входных данных.

• Способность сети самостоятельно обучается на выборке данных (которая называется «обучающей выборкой»). Самостоятельно определяет значимость

каждого из параметров, и его влияние. Также имеется возможность обучить сеть самому с помощью учителя.

• Способность нейронов сети делать точный прогноз на данных, не принадлежащих исходному общему множеству.

• Сеть может дополнительно обучаться при поступлении новых данных.

• Возможность работы с неполными данными с меньшей вероятностью ухудшения прогноза чем у других методов.

На сегодняшний день широко применяются несколько типов ИНС: многослойный персептрон, сети на основе радиальных базисных функций, карты самоорганизации, рекуррентные нейронные сети.

Основное преимущество нейронных сетей заключается в способности обучаться на примерах. В большинстве случаев обучение представляет собой процесс изменения весовых коэффициентов-синапсов по определенному алгоритму. При этом, как правило, требуется много примеров и много циклов обучения.

В прогнозировании нейронные сети используются чаще всего по простейшей схеме: в качестве входных данных в сеть подается предварительно обработанная инфор-

мация о значениях прогнозируемого параметра за несколько предыдущих периодов, на выходе сеть выдает прогноз на следующие периоды.

Нейронные сети можно разделить на три основные группы:

1. Полносвязные.

Нейрон передает свой входной сигнал остальным нейронам, в том числе и самому себе. Все входные сигналы подаются всем нейронам. Выходными сигналами могут быть все или некоторые выходные сигналы нейронов после нескольких тактов функционирования сети.

2. Многослойные или слоистые.

Нейроны объединяются в слои. Слой содержит совокупность нейронов с едиными входными сигналами. Число нейронов в слое может быть любым. В общем случае сеть состоит из Q слоев, пронумерованных слева направо. Внешние входные сигналы подаются на входы нейронов входного слоя (нулевой), а выходами сети являются выходные сигналы последнего слоя. Кроме входного и выходного слоев в многослойной нейронной сети есть один или несколько скрытых слоев.

3. Слабосвязанные (с локальными связями).

Нейроны располагаются в узлах прямоугольной

или гексагональной решетки. Каждый нейрон связан с четырьмя (окрестность фон Неймана), шестью (окрестность Голея) или восемью (окрестность Мура) своими ближайшими соседями.

Рисунок 2. Архитектура многослойного персептрона

Наиболее популярным является многослойный персептрон, который состоит из множества сенсорных элементов (входных нейронов), образующих входной слой; одного или нескольких скрытых слоев вычислительных нейронов, не являющихся частью входа или выхода сети, и одного выходного слоя нейронов. Такая сеть обладает высокой степенью связанности, реализуемой посредством синаптических соединений. Многослойный персеп-трон имеет высокую вычислительную мощность и имеет достаточно высокую скорость и точность для прогнозирования электропотребления.

Среди недостатков нейронных сетей можно назвать: длительное время обучения, склонность к подстройке под обучающие данные и снижение обобщающих способностей с ростом времени обучения. Кроме того, невозможно объяснить, каким образом сеть приходит к тому или иному решению задачи. Но такие недостатки несущественны на фоне преимуществ ИНС.

1. Генетические алгоритмы.

Впервые были предложены Дж.Холландом в 1976 году.В их основе лежит направленный случайный поиск, то есть попытка моделирования эволюционных процессов

в природе. Генетические алгоритмы работают так: Решение задачи представляется в виде особи. Создается случайный набор особей - популяция, это изначальное поколение решений. Популяции обрабатываются специальными операторами репродукции и мутации. Т.е. как бы переживают одно поколение (эпоху). Производится оценка решений и их селекция на основе функции пригодности. Особи с худшими параметрами удаляются, а с лучшими остаются, в результате чего увеличивается точность прогноза. Выводится поколение решений, и цикл повторяется. В результате с каждой эпохой эволюции находятся более совершенные решения.

В прогнозировании генетические алгоритмы редко используются напрямую, так как сложно придумать критерий оценки прогноза, то есть критерий отбора решений. Поэтому обычно генетические алгоритмы служат вспомогательным методом - например, при обучении нейронной сети с нестандартными активационными функциями, при которых невозможно применение градиентных алгоритмов.

2. Прогнозирование с использованием гибридных систем.

Гибридная система - система, состоящая из двух и более интегрированных разнородных подсистем. Подобный подход дает возможность компенсировать недостатки одних моделей при помощи других и направлен на повышение точности прогнозирования, как одного из главных критериев эффективности модели.

Одним из примеров гибридных систем является использование нечетких нейронных сетей в качестве основы для построения прогнозной модели. Нечеткая ИНС - четкая нейронная сеть, построенная на основе многослойной архитектуры с использованием «И»-, «ИЛИ»-нейронов. Т.е. вместо четкого ответа 0 или 1 результат может принимать значения от 0 до 1.

Существуют следующие типы комбинаций гибридных моделей прогнозирования:

нейронные сети + нечеткая логика; нейронные сети + ARIMA; нейронные сети + регрессия; нейронные сети + генетические алгоритмы нейронные сети + GA + нечеткая логика; В большинстве комбинаций модели на основе нейронных сетей применяются для решения задачи кластеризации, а далее для каждого кластера строиться отдельная модель прогнозирования на основе АЯГМА, GA, нечеткой логики и др. Применение комбинированных моделей, выполняющих предварительную кластеризации и последующее прогнозирование внутри определенного кластера, является самым перспективным направлением развития моделей прогнозирования.

Применение в гибридных моделях нечетких нейронных сетей, позволяет добиться существенного улучшения адаптивности и обобщающей способности прогнозной модели по сравнению с традиционными ИНС.

Количество возможных вариантов нейронных сетей настолько велико, что необходима методика по формированию оптимальных параметров сети. Такой методикой являются генетические алгоритмы.

Применение генетических алгоритмов позволяет получить оптимальную конфигурацию нейронной сети, а значит наилучшую прогнозную модель электропотребления на ее основе, а также упростить сам процесс формирования нейронной сети.

Главным недостатком комбинированных моделей является сложность и ресурсоемкость их разработки: нужно разработать модели таким образом, чтобы компенсировать недостатки каждой из них, не потеряв достоинств.

Определено, что наиболее перспективным направлением развития моделей прогнозирования с целью повышения точности является создание комбинированных моделей, на основе нейронных сетей в связи с очевидными преимуществами ИНС над остальными методами прогнозирования. Оптимальная прогнозная модель должна быть легко обучаема, иметь небольшое время обучения, адаптироваться к изменениям окружающей среды, легко корректироваться, стабильно работать в нестационарной среде. Все эти свойства присущи ИНС. Это позволяет сделать вывод о том, что наилучшим по совокупности характеристик методом для автоматизации прогнозирования электропотребления будет методика гибридных систем на основе ИНС.

Список литературы

1. Искусственные нейронные сети, режим доступа к изд.: www.coolreferat.com

2. Круглов В.В., Борисов В.В. «Искусственные нейронные сети 2-е издание»

3. Методы прогнозирования национальной экономики, режим доступа к изд.: www.bibliofond.ru

4. Чучуева И., диссертация на тему: «модель прогнозирования временных рядов по выборке максимального подобия»

О ПУТЯХ СОВЕРШЕНСТВОВАНИЯ ТОРМОЗНОЙ СИСТЕМЫ ГРУЗОВЫХ ВАГОНОВ

Гущин Павел Александрович Лысцев Роман Андреевич Подлесников Ярослав Дмитриевич

Аспирант кафедры «Вагоны и вагонное хозяйство» МГУПС (МИИТ), г. Москва

Известно, что типовая тормозная система грузовых вагонов имеет определенные недостатки, к числу которых относятся неплотности соединений, дефекты и неисправности тормозных приборов, изгибы элементов тормозной рычажной передачи. Помимо этого, человеческим фактором обусловлена неправильная настройка тормозных приборов и неправильная регулировка ТРП. Вследствие перечисленных недостатков снижается эффективность тормозов вагонов, которая выражается силой нажатия тормозных колодок меньше или больше допустимой. В связи с этим на поверхности катания колес образуются такие дефекты как ползун и навар, значительно быстрее происходит образование проката и выщербин.

Усугубляет положение применение на грузовых вагонах композиционных тормозных колодок, которые практически не отводят тепловую энергию от зоны контакта колодки с колесом, в отличие от чугунных колодок.

К тому же композиционные колодки приводят к образованию такого дефекта как кольцевые выработки на поверхности катания колеса.

Что касается человеческого фактора, для правильной настройки тормозной системы необходимо установить в нужную позицию переключатели на воздухораспределителе и правильно отрегулировать ТРП. Помимо этого, в обязанности осмотрщика вагонов входит проверка работоспособности и замена неисправных тормозных приборов. Также возможно допущение брака при ремонте тормозной системы, например, недостаточное количество смазки на поршне тормозного цилиндра может привести к неуходу штока и, соответственно, неотпуску тормозов.

Для повышения безотказности работы тормозной системы и снижения влияния человеческого фактора на безопасность движения поездов разрабатываются и внедряются различные устройства и приборы. Например, при-

i Надоели баннеры? Вы всегда можете отключить рекламу.